Here are some things to know about the month of November:
1. November is the last month of the year with 30 days. The others, as that childhood rhyme reminds us, are April, June and September.Â

2. For Roman Catholics, today is Al Souls Day, known in Mexico as the Day of the Dead. The month is dedicated to praying for the dead.

4. In the United States, it has recently become known as No-Shave November or Noshember. Men often grow a beard in the month to raise awareness of a variety of charities and men's health issues, mainly testicular and prostate cancer.
